WebSep 28, 2024 · Apply the compound to the cut on the Timberland boot with the included spatula. Allow it to dry for 1 hour. Apply a second and third compound patch to the cut if needed. Allow each patch to dry for 1 hour before adding the next. Choose a pattern that resembles the grain pattern on the boot from the repair kit's included grain paper packet. WebJan 20, 2024 · Try a Simple Fix. First, try to erase scuff marks on your Timberland boots, whether they're suede or leather. Using the eraser on a Number 2 pencil, a Mr. Clean Magic Eraser or a similar product, gently rub the scuff mark on the boot. As you do, you may want to use a clean cloth to wipe away any debris and see if the eraser works. Video of the Day.
